| 4.0 excellent | Trey STAFF | August 29th 14 | Cannibal Corpse have been working towards A Skeletal Domain ever since they added George Fisher on vocals back in 1995. His addition allowed them to move towards a more rhythmic and dynamic direction Chris Barnes’ deep grunts just wouldn’t have fit. Including Pat O’Brien (ex-Nevermore) on lead guitar in 1997 only solidified that direction and allowed them to also start including random bouts of technicality. A Skeletal Domain is definitely a death metal album, but it also pushes some boundaries. Cannibal Corpse have pushed the technicality of their songs without forgetting the brutality or speed fans have come to expect. They have also added a thrash element that periodically rears its head before being murdered by another blast beat and atonal guitar solo. Together all of these elements have created a Cannibal Corpse album that is darker and more chaotic than normal, but that is somehow probably their most accessible.

| 3.7 great | Voivod STAFF | December 28th 14 | Since 2006, Cannibal Corpse have been making a conscious effort in escaping the old school death metal "bulkiness" that characterized their previous releases. A Skeletal Domain sees the band diversifying its core characteristics through technical playing, the adoption of thrash metal and finally, the relative modernization of the sound production. The album works well as a whole, as relatively few tracks ("High Velocity Impact Spatter", "Sadistic Embodiment", "Funeral Cremation") kind of stand out from the lot.
